item.page.abstract

Broncho-obstructive syndrome (BOS) is an inflammation of the bronchi, accompanied by severe swelling of the bronchi and the production of large amounts of mucus. This substance is difficult to expel, causing mucus to stagnate and create a favorable environment for bacteria. Bronchial obstruction is dangerous due to the development of respiratory failure and oxygen starvation, which is especially dangerous for small children.
